Hi Dan,

before deciding in which direction we can help you, please check if the core is running.

Open MIOS Studio, connect to the core and enter "help" in the MIOS terminal -> do you get some messages?

Thereafter enter "play" -> does the sequencer start to play?

Best Regards, Thorsten.

Hiya,

I had to set the jumper @ J15-S to 5 volts to get my v4 lite working,yours may be different but I thought it might be worth a mention.
